发明

一种数据服务接口鉴权方法及接口网关系统

2023-05-12 09:55:44 发布于四川 8
  • 申请专利号:CN202310068160.9
  • 公开(公告)日:2023-05-02
  • 公开(公告)号:CN116055043A
  • 申请人:国家气象信息中心(中国气象局气象数据中心)
摘要:本发明公开一种数据服务接口鉴权方法及接口网关系统,鉴权方法:生成当前时间戳和随机字符串;将调用者标识、用户秘钥、时间戳和随机字符串拼接到数据请求参数中;按照数据请求参数名的字母升序排列数据请求参数;对数据请求参数数据串进行算法加密,并将加密字符串转成大写,形成参数签名参数;将调用者标识、随机字符串、时间戳和参数签名拼接在数据请求参数中,形成调用请求;判断调用者标识和参数签名是否合法,时间戳是否有效,唯一随机字符串是否存在于服务端集合之中;根据判断结果进行放行或者返回错误码。接口网关系统包括采用上述鉴权方法进行鉴权的用户认证模块。本发明解决了气象数据接口安全性差和服务接口不统一的问题。

专利内容

(19)国家知识产权局 (12)发明专利申请 (10)申请公布号 CN 116055043 A (43)申请公布日 2023.05.02 (21)申请号 202310068160.9 (22)申请日 2023.02.06 (71)申请人 国家气象信息中心(中国气象局气 象数据中心) 地址 100081 北京市海淀区中关村南大街 46号 (72)发明人 倪学磊 徐拥军 何文春 王琦  何林 张晓 金培文  (74)专利代理机构 北京冠榆知识产权代理事务 所(特殊普通合伙) 11666 专利代理师 孟培 (51)Int.Cl. H04L 9/08 (2006.01) H04L 9/32 (2006.01) H04L 9/40 (2022.01) 权利要求书1页 说明书4页 附图2页 (54)发明名称 一种数据服务接口鉴权方法及接口网关系 统 (57)摘要 本发明公开一种数据服务接口鉴权方法及 接口网关系统,鉴权方法:生成当前时间戳和随 机字符串;将调用者标识、用户秘钥、时间戳和随 机字符串拼接到数据请求参数中;按照数据请求 参数名的字母升序排列数据请求参数;对数据请 求参数数据串进行算法加密,并将加密字符串转 成大写,形成参数签名参数;将调用者标识、随机 字符串、时间戳和参数签名拼接在数据请求参数 中,形成调用请求;判断调用者标识和参数签名 是否合法,时间戳是否有效,唯一随机字符串是 否存在于服务端集合之中

最新专利